小编Pit*_*rak的帖子

AWS Elastic Beanstalk - Flask 部署

我尝试在 AWS EB 中设置 Flask 应用程序,并在日志上运行此问题。

Failed to find attribute 'application' in 'app'.

我的应用程序正在使用应用程序工厂,因此 init 是在函数中设置的。

def create_app(config_name):
    app = Flask(__name__)
    from .api.routes import api

    app.register_blueprint(api, url_prefix="/api/v1")

    from .main import main

    app.register_blueprint(main)
    app.run()
    return app
Run Code Online (Sandbox Code Playgroud)

我已更改 WSGIPath 以匹配我的应用程序名称和对象:

aws:elasticbeanstalk:container:python:
    NumProcesses: '1'
    NumThreads: '15'
    WSGIPath: app
Run Code Online (Sandbox Code Playgroud)

我的应用程序结构如下所示:

 __init__.py(empty)
 app.py
 main.py
 requirements.txt
 api/
     __init___.py (empty)
     routes.py 
Run Code Online (Sandbox Code Playgroud)

我缺少什么?我感觉自己如此亲近,同时又如此遥远。

感谢您的帮助。

python cloud deployment flask amazon-elastic-beanstalk

2
推荐指数
1
解决办法
1289
查看次数

使用带有 key 参数的 map python

我有一个看起来像这样的函数:

def myFunct(arg1=None,arg2=None,arg3=None):
    pass
Run Code Online (Sandbox Code Playgroud)

我想将该函数与 map 函数一起使用,但仅使用参数 1 和 3。想法是:

map(myFunct,list_arg1,list_arg3)

Run Code Online (Sandbox Code Playgroud)

所以每个电话都是 myFunct(value1,arg3=value3)

我怎么能做到这一点?

function python-3.x

0
推荐指数
1
解决办法
35
查看次数

将对象转换为Int pandas

您好,我遇到了将对象的列转换为完整列的整数的问题。

我有一个数据框,我尝试将一些检测为对象的列转换为Integer(或Float),但我已经找到的所有答案都对我有用:(

第一状态

然后,我尝试应用to_numeric方法,但不起作用。 数值方法

然后是一个自定义方法,您可以在这里找到:熊猫:将dtype'object'转换为int 但也不起作用:(data3['Title'].astype(str).astype(int) 对不起,我无法再传递图像-您必须相信我,它不起作用)

我尝试使用inplace语句,但似乎未集成到这些方法中:

我很确定答案是愚蠢的,但找不到它:(有人能帮助我吗?

谢谢

python-3.x pandas

-1
推荐指数
1
解决办法
1万
查看次数